LDC demands GDC, ITI at Latti

Excelsior Correspondent
UDHAMPUR, Sept 17: Latti Development Committee (LDC) has urged upon the State Administration to sanction Industrial Training Institute (ITI) and a Govt Degree College (GDC) at Latti tehsil headquarters besides up-gradation of Govt High School at Dudu to the Higher Secondary level in district Udhampur.
Members of the LDC including Sarpanch Latti, Kasturi Lal Gupta and Sarpanch Dudu, Dev Raj who also projected the demands of the people from this remote area of district Udhampur before the Advisor, Farooq Khan the other day, said that while almost all the tehsils of district Udhampur including Chenani, Ramnagar, Majalta etc have been sanctioned Degree Colleges but the remote Latti Tehsil has been ignored. Moreover, there is no ITI in the entire area.
They demanded that Govt is already focusing on skill development, but this entire Latti-Dudu -Basantgarh belt has not even a single ITI. They demanded that an ITI be sanctioned at Latti so that local boys and girls could get employment opportunities. They also demanded up-gradation of Govt High School Dudu (Parla) to the Higher Secondary level and posting of SDO, at Sub Divisional Horticulture Office, Latti which is lying vacant for the last 4 years. They demanded proper monitoring of all the Tehsil level offices in the area.
